Canada - Export of X-Ray Tubes
Since 2014, Canada Export of X-Ray Tubes decreased by 2.1% year on year. In 2019, the country was number 15 comparing other countries in Export of X-Ray Tubes at $9,733,847. Canada is overtaken by Russia, which was number 14 at $10,986,291.17 and is followed by Denmark at $9,168,844. United States topped the ranking with $605,352,358.33 in 2019, that is an increase of 7.5% versus 2018. Germany, Singapore and Netherlands resp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Morocco recorded the best 5 years average growth at +177% per year, while Saint Lucia witnessed the worst performance at -64.4% per year.
